Core Innovation

This paper introduces CODE-II, a large-scale, real-world ECG dataset with 66 clinically meaningful diagnostic classes annotated and reviewed by cardiologists. It surpasses prior datasets in size, annotation quality, and clinical relevance, enabling superior AI model training and transfer performance on external benchmarks.

Why It Matters

Accurate ECG interpretation is critical for timely cardiac care but is limited by data quality and scale. CODE-II addresses these gaps by providing a large, well-annotated dataset that improves AI diagnostic accuracy and generalizability. This enables healthcare providers to scale ECG analysis efficiently and improve patient outcomes globally.
